Overview

The Employee Relations Specialist is a hands-on practitioner responsible for ensuring a fair, consistent, and legally compliant workplace across a multi-state environment. This role serves as a trusted advisor to leaders and employees by managing sensitive employee relations matters, conducting prompt and neutral workplace investigations, and strengthening manager capability through practical coaching and policy guidance.

In Short

  • Serve as a primary point of contact for employee relations inquiries, concerns, and complaints.
  • Provide timely, practical guidance to leaders and HR partners on appropriate interventions.
  • Use the designated ER ticketing and case management system to log intake and actions.
  • Conduct prompt, neutral, and well-documented investigations related to workplace misconduct.
  • Coach leaders on performance management and documentation quality.
  • Partner with HR Business Partners and Operations leaders to resolve workplace issues early.
  • Support adherence to federal, state, and local employment laws.
  • Track ER themes and trends and recommend proactive interventions.
  • Support regulatory audits or external inquiries as assigned.
  • Contribute to the development of workplace policies and ER playbooks.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Psychology, or a related field.
  • 3–5 years of employee relations experience including hands-on workplace investigations.
  • Working knowledge of employment laws and employee relations best practices.
  • Strong interviewing, documentation, analytical,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age sensitive matters with discretion and professionalism.
  • Experience in healthcare, behavioral health, or human services environments.
  • Experience supporting multi-state or rapidly growing organizations.

Clarvida - Idaho

Clarvida is a national agency dedicated to providing comprehensive support and services to individuals with severe mental illness. Through its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) program, Clarvida focuses on person-centered assistance, helping clients achieve greater independence and improved quality of life. The organization emphasizes growth and stability, offering a supportive work environment for its employees, including opportunities for remote work, professional development, and competitive benefits.
